    Call of Duty: Black Ops Cold War Allows Players to Adjust Haptic Feedback

    Upcoming video game Call of Duty: Black Ops Cold War will be launching its open beta soon on all platforms, which fans and curious players will be able try out for the first time multiplayer gameplay.

    We have recently talked with Treyarch’s developers together with other Southeast Asian media outlets about the upcoming open beta and of course other details that are related to the game. One of those is related to the PlayStation 5 and its controller, the DualSense.

    Treyarch Lead Game Designer Matt Scronce shared some juicy information about the DualSense controller. According to him, the “PS5 has the DualSense controller with the haptic feedback and the [adaptive] triggers. That’s something very exciting that we’ve been playing around with.”

    Scronce revealed that in Black Ops Cold War, players can actually adjust the haptic feedback and adaptive triggers to their liking. “When you fire a gun, you will feel a little bit of feedback there,” he said. “It’s going to have some tension. And you will be able to adjust the intensity of the haptic feedback and turn those off individually.”

    As of writing, only Treyarch has officially confirmed that the haptic feedback and the adaptive triggers can actually be turned off or on and customized to one’s personal liking. Other PlayStation 5 titles do not have these types of features as of yet, but it is most likely that other studios will be offering similar settings as well. It is cool that you have to option to do that or just feel what the game has to offer in default settings.

    Call of Duty: Black Ops Cold War will launch on November 13 on PC, PlayStation 4, Xbox One, Xbox Series X/S, and PlayStation 5.
